Output bc58120bf4e5d10afd6ff68b0f94a57675a6c564b0d369e2fc5d73efc9673742:3

value
28697918
script pubkey
OP_HASH160 OP_PUSHBYTES_20 561fb08b6bf51825b6f98fd587b162b814cbc4f1 OP_EQUAL
address
MFkYJm7zmfGNMB8Jvcs8keWcajM3tBfdE8
transaction
bc58120bf4e5d10afd6ff68b0f94a57675a6c564b0d369e2fc5d73efc9673742
spent
true